Defining Balance Bike Specifications
The materials and components you specify directly dictate the product's market positioning, shipping weight, and unit cost. Professional buyers must clearly define frame materials, tire composition, and bearing grades before soliciting quotations.
Frame Materials & Construction
Frame material is the primary driver of both cost and rider experience. While entry-level markets tolerate heavier materials, premium brands increasingly demand ultra-lightweight alloys.
| Material | Weight Profile | Cost Impact | Market Positioning |
|---|---|---|---|
| Carbon Steel | Heavy (approx. 3.5 - 4.5kg) | Low | Entry-level retail & mass market |
| Aluminum Alloy | Lightweight (approx. 2.5 - 3.0kg) | Medium | Mid-tier to premium brands |
| Magnesium Alloy | Ultra-light (under 2.5kg) | High | High-end performance & specialty |
| Plywood / Wood | Variable (often 3.0kg+) | Medium-High | Eco-friendly & boutique retail |
Tire and Bearing Selection
Tire specification is a major cost variable. EVA foam tires are puncture-proof, maintenance-free, and cost-effective, making them the standard for indoor or entry-level models. Pneumatic (air-filled) rubber tires offer superior traction and shock absorption for outdoor use but add significant cost and weight. For the wheel hubs, specifying sealed ABEC-5 or ABEC-7 bearings is critical; unsealed bearings degrade rapidly when exposed to dirt and moisture, leading to high return rates.

Ride-on toys face some of the strictest regulatory scrutiny in the world. Failing to verify a factory's compliance capabilities before production can result in customs seizures or costly recalls.
Critical Safety Standards
Depending on your target market, balance bikes must pass rigorous third-party testing. Manufacturers must provide valid test reports, but buyers should always independently verify compliance through rigorous Compliance & Testing protocols.
- North America: ASTM F963 (Physical and mechanical testing) and CPSIA (Lead and phthalate limits in surface coatings and accessible substrates).
- Europe: EN71 (Parts 1, 2, and 3 covering mechanical, flammability, and heavy metal migration) and REACH directives.
- Australia/New Zealand: AS/NZS ISO 8124.
Factory Floor Quality Control
Quality is won or lost during fabrication and finishing. When assessing a supplier or conducting Factory Audits, pay close attention to their in-house quality management systems.
Key Inspection Points for Balance Bikes
- Weld Integrity: Inspect TIG/MIG welds for porosity, undercutting, or sharp slag that could cause injury.
- Frame Alignment: Ensure the head tube and rear dropouts are perfectly aligned to prevent steering bias.
- Surface Finish Adhesion: Test paint or anodized layers for flaking, ensuring all coatings are strictly non-toxic.
- Hardware Safety: Verify that all axles, bolts, and clamps use acorn nuts or recessed fittings to eliminate sharp protrusions.
- Handlebar Grips: Ensure grips feature flared ends for impact protection and are securely bonded to prevent removal and choking hazards.
OEM/ODM Customization and Branding
For brands looking to differentiate, OEM/ODM Services offer pathways from simple private labeling to entirely custom frame geometries.
Private labeling an existing "off-the-shelf" factory mold (ODM) requires lower MOQs and zero tooling costs. You can customize the paint colors (using precise Pantone matching), water-transfer decals, saddle embroidery, and retail packaging. Developing a custom frame (OEM) requires investing in new tooling (tube bending jigs or die-casting molds for magnesium), which increases upfront costs and lead times but provides exclusive market IP.
